A coupling system for a towing vehicle, including a measuring element, wherein the coupling system has a fifth-wheel coupling plate on which a conically widened insertion region that is located in the longitudinal axis (x) of said plate and is intended for the introduction of a trailer-side coupling means and an adjoining locking region are formed, and at least two bearing blocks that engage laterally on the fifth-wheel coupling plate are provided, wherein the measuring element is situated in a mounting region of the coupling system such that operating forces (F, F) acting in the longitudinal axis (x) and/or a transverse axis (y) are determined thereby. A coupling system of which the measuring element is subjected to significantly lower wear effect. A bearing shell and a measuring shell are situated between at least one of the bearing blocks and the fifth wheel coupling plate, the mounting region being formed from the measuring shell.
